容器应用管理对性能的影响分析?

在当今数字化时代,容器应用管理已成为企业提升应用性能、优化资源利用的关键手段。本文将从多个角度分析容器应用管理对性能的影响,以期为读者提供有益的参考。

一、容器应用管理概述

容器应用管理是指通过容器技术对应用进行打包、部署、运行和监控的过程。它能够将应用与基础设施解耦,实现快速迭代、弹性伸缩和资源隔离,从而提高应用性能和稳定性。

二、容器应用管理对性能的影响

  1. 部署速度
  • 容器化:容器化技术将应用及其依赖打包成一个独立的容器,可以快速部署到任意环境,节省了部署时间。
  • 镜像仓库:通过镜像仓库管理容器镜像,可以快速获取最新版本的应用,降低部署延迟。

  1. 资源利用率
  • 资源隔离:容器技术实现了应用之间的资源隔离,避免资源竞争,提高资源利用率。
  • 动态伸缩:根据业务需求动态调整容器数量,实现资源的最优配置。

  1. 性能优化
  • 轻量级:容器比虚拟机轻量级,减少了系统开销,提高了应用性能。
  • 微服务架构:容器技术支持微服务架构,将应用拆分成多个独立的服务,便于优化和扩展。

  1. 运维效率
  • 自动化部署:容器应用管理工具可以实现自动化部署,降低运维成本。
  • 故障自愈:容器技术支持故障自愈,提高系统稳定性。

三、案例分析

以某大型电商平台为例,该平台采用容器应用管理技术后,取得了以下成果:

  • 部署速度提升:容器化技术将部署时间缩短了50%,提高了业务上线速度。
  • 资源利用率提升:通过动态伸缩,资源利用率提高了30%。
  • 性能提升:应用性能提升了20%,用户体验得到显著改善。

四、总结

容器应用管理对性能的影响主要体现在部署速度、资源利用率、性能优化和运维效率等方面。通过合理运用容器技术,企业可以提升应用性能,降低运维成本,实现业务快速迭代。

关键词:容器应用管理、性能、部署速度、资源利用率、微服务架构、自动化部署、故障自愈

猜你喜欢:网络流量采集